lancer un script a l'arret de windows

lancer un script a l'arret de windows - Win NT/2K/XP - Windows & Software

Marsh Posté le 26-10-2006 à 11:21:02    

slt tlm, voila je veux lancer un script lorsque windows s'arrete ( '98 2000 XP )
pour 2000 j'ai essayer de lui dire dans strategiede group, machine, arret de windows. J'y ai rajouter mon script j'ai arreté l'ordi il marque bien execution de script et 2 sec apres arret de la machine ( mon script necessite plus de 2 sec pour faire tout ce qu'il doit faire )  
et si je regarde le resultat de mon script c'est comme s'il n'avait jamais été lancé !


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 26-10-2006 à 11:21:02   

Reply

Marsh Posté le 26-10-2006 à 14:06:52    

tu peux ns mettre le script en question ?

Reply

Marsh Posté le 26-10-2006 à 16:08:36    

cvb a écrit :

tu peux ns mettre le script en question ?



net use \\192.168.0.12\partage "pass" /user:"user"  
 
xcopy /d/e/c/h/i/y/v/s C:\dossier \\192.168.0.12\Partage\dossier\
xcopy /d/e/c/h/i/y/v/s C:\dossier2 \\192.168.0.12\Partage\dossier2\
....


 
edit : si je lance le fichier.bat a la main ca marche !


Message édité par carot0 le 26-10-2006 à 16:09:01

---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 26-10-2006 à 16:12:21    

Ton script est positionné où ? Sur un partage réseau ? Tu t'es assuré que ce partage était bien accessible au groupe "Tout le monde", ou au moins à l'utilisateur SYSTEM ?

Reply

Marsh Posté le 26-10-2006 à 16:15:46    

Wolfman a écrit :

Ton script est positionné où ? Sur un partage réseau ? Tu t'es assuré que ce partage était bien accessible au groupe "Tout le monde", ou au moins à l'utilisateur SYSTEM ?


il est en local sur le poste, tout a fait accessible!


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 26-10-2006 à 16:18:35    

Modifie ton script et met un truc beaucoup plus simple à l'intérieur :
 

dir c: > c:\test.txt


 
 
Tu fais ton test. Si ton script s'est bien exécuté, un fichier test.txt sera dispo sur ton C. Ca permettra déjà de voir si c'est le lancement du script qui coince, ou son contenu.

Reply

Marsh Posté le 27-10-2006 à 09:22:20    

j'ai rajouté un dir c: > c:\test.txt en debut de mon script et c'est bien executé ! par contre le reste .... tjs pas :/


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 10:31:17    

carot0 a écrit :

j'ai rajouté un dir c: > c:\test.txt en debut de mon script et c'est bien executé ! par contre le reste .... tjs pas :/


j'ai mis des redirection de sortie sur toutes les ligne de mon script :  
la 1er net use semble ne pas marcher ce qui fait que les autre ne marche pas
est 'il possible que windows coupe la connection reseau avant l'execution de mon script ?


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 10:42:35    

J'ai le même genre de script sur une machine, mais je l'ai mis à la fermeture de session et non l'arrêt du pc.


---------------
Mon Blog : LeVeilleur.net | Hébergement d'images : Hostipics.net
Reply

Marsh Posté le 27-10-2006 à 10:44:04    

Le Veilleur a écrit :

J'ai le même genre de script sur une machine, mais je l'ai mis à la fermeture de session et non l'arrêt du pc.


je vais essayer comme ca !


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 10:44:04   

Reply

Marsh Posté le 27-10-2006 à 10:45:50    

carot0 a écrit :

je vais essayer comme ca !


C'est donc une gpo user ;)


---------------
Mon Blog : LeVeilleur.net | Hébergement d'images : Hostipics.net
Reply

Marsh Posté le 27-10-2006 à 10:48:26    

Le Veilleur a écrit :

C'est donc une gpo user ;)


c'est bon ca l'aire de marcher !
thx


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 12:26:44    

Il y a fort a parier qu a la fermeture de la session, les variable d environnement existe toujour, donc pas de probleme pour trouver Xcopy
 
par contre la session n existant plus a la fermeture de la machine, il doit pas trouver Xcopy (placé dans c:\windows ou c:\winnt ou ... a toi de le trouver.)
 
enssuite, il y a le probleme d acces a "C:\dossier" qui a le droit de lecture sur ce dossier ?

Message cité 1 fois
Message édité par z_cool le 27-10-2006 à 12:27:13
Reply

Marsh Posté le 27-10-2006 à 13:47:25    

z_cool a écrit :

Il y a fort a parier qu a la fermeture de la session, les variable d environnement existe toujour, donc pas de probleme pour trouver Xcopy
 
par contre la session n existant plus a la fermeture de la machine, il doit pas trouver Xcopy (placé dans c:\windows ou c:\winnt ou ... a toi de le trouver.)
 
enssuite, il y a le probleme d acces a "C:\dossier" qui a le droit de lecture sur ce dossier ?


xcopy est bien trouver et me retourn le message "0 fichier copié" comme si il ne trouvait pas la destination ou la source ( je penche pour la destination qui est introuvable)


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 14:17:49    

carot0 a écrit :

xcopy est bien trouver et me retourn le message "0 fichier copié" comme si il ne trouvait pas la destination ou la source ( je penche pour la destination qui est introuvable)


 
 
moi je penche pour la source ou il n a pas les droits d acces non ?

Reply

Marsh Posté le 27-10-2006 à 14:52:31    

z_cool a écrit :

moi je penche pour la source ou il n a pas les droits d acces non ?


normalement il doit pas y avoir de probleme d'acces a la source, quand je lance le script moi meme ca passe....


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 14:58:24    

carot0 a écrit :

normalement il doit pas y avoir de probleme d'acces a la source, quand je lance le script moi meme ca passe....


 
 
oui, mais toi .... tu est toi (puissant non ce que je dis parfois.  :pt1cable: )
 
quand tu est en extinction d ordinateur, et si ta session est déjà fermé, je suis pas sur que tu ai encore une quelconque identité sur ta machine. et c est uniquement le systeme qui travail.

Reply

Marsh Posté le 27-10-2006 à 20:04:48    

z_cool a écrit :

oui, mais toi .... tu est toi (puissant non ce que je dis parfois.  :pt1cable: )
 
quand tu est en extinction d ordinateur, et si ta session est déjà fermé, je suis pas sur que tu ai encore une quelconque identité sur ta machine. et c est uniquement le systeme qui travail.


et a ce moment la le systeme n'a pas les droit de l'admin ???
mais c'est vraiment de la m**** windows


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 27-10-2006 à 20:18:28    

Si tu conclus "c'est de la merde" a chaque fois qu'un truc ne fonctionne pas comme tu penses qu'il fonctionne, tu vas pas aller bien loin...
 
Et le compte "system" a bien les droits d'admin sur la machine, par contre comme pour un compte admin classique si tu le vire des droits NTFS sur des fichiers/dossiers il pourra rien faire, regarde par exemple ce qu'il en ai avec les droits sur net.exe et xcopy.exe
Vérifie aussi si ton path a pas un probleme, met les chemins complets vers les commandes dans ton script.
Et jette aussi un coup d'oeil dans les journaux d'evenements voir si y'a rien au moment des arrêts.

Message cité 1 fois
Message édité par El Pollo Diablo le 27-10-2006 à 20:19:00
Reply

Marsh Posté le 27-10-2006 à 21:13:09    

El Pollo Diablo a écrit :

Si tu conclus "c'est de la merde" a chaque fois qu'un truc ne fonctionne pas comme tu penses qu'il fonctionne, tu vas pas aller bien loin...
 
Et le compte "system" a bien les droits d'admin sur la machine, par contre comme pour un compte admin classique si tu le vire des droits NTFS sur des fichiers/dossiers il pourra rien faire, regarde par exemple ce qu'il en ai avec les droits sur net.exe et xcopy.exe
Vérifie aussi si ton path a pas un probleme, met les chemins complets vers les commandes dans ton script.
Et jette aussi un coup d'oeil dans les journaux d'evenements voir si y'a rien au moment des arrêts.


c'est une conclusion evidente a laquelle j'arrive a chaque fois que je dois me servire du poste equipé de windows....
je vais verifier tout ce que tu m'as indiqué
 
merci pour l'aide !


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le 28-10-2006 à 08:14:26    

carot0 a écrit :

c'est une conclusion evidente a laquelle j'arrive a chaque fois que je dois me servire du poste equipé de windows....
je vais verifier tout ce que tu m'as indiqué
 
merci pour l'aide !


 
 
ba .... reste sur ce dont tu a l habitude.
Perso, je me suis souvent fait des script lancé avec Cron sous Linux, c est la même chose .... sauf que la regèle de base dans ce cas la, c'est de jamais rien lancer en ROOT, sécurité oblige ....


Message édité par z_cool le 28-10-2006 à 08:15:50
Reply

Marsh Posté le 02-11-2006 à 12:20:57    

j'aurai une autre question :  
a l'arret du systeme ( ou fermeture de la session ) il y a un temps max pour l'execution des script ?


---------------
In a world without walls and fences, who needs Windows and Gates
Reply

Marsh Posté le    

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ed